Phoenix Coyotes sign Michigan defenseman Chris Summers to entry level deal

By AnnArbor.com Staff

GLENDALE, Ariz. — The Phoenix Coyotes have signed defenceman Chris Summers, one of their two first-round draft picks in 2006, to an entry level contract.

Terms of the deal were not disclosed.

Coyotes general manager Don Maloney says the 22-year-old Summers will report to the team's American Hockey League affiliate in San Antonio.

Summers, who served as Michigan's captain this season, returned to the Wolverines line-up for the NCAA Tournament after missing Michigan's the past two weeks with a leg injury.

Summers four goals and 12 assists in 40 games this season. In his four-year career with the Wolverines, Summers had 16 goals, 44 assists, 191 penalty minutes and a plus-66 rating.

Fellow Michigan senior defenseman Steve Kampfer signed a contract with the Boston Bruins Tuesday and was assigned to the club's AHL affiliate in Providence, R.I.
